An excerpt from the article titled “Beirut: The Centre of Disruptive Innovation” is posted below:
The technology and innovation ecosystem in Beirut is becoming a mini-Silicon Valley for the Middle East. There has been a spate of successful startups: Presella the “Eventbrite of the Middle East” has raised almost $400,000 so far and has rapidly expanded its user base in Middle Eastern markets; Anghami, the iTunes of the Middle East, has 33 million users; Pou, a game based on an alien pet, is currently making millions of dollars on the App Store. Moreover, LittleBits, Cinemoz and such platforms such as Ki, Zoomaal, Sohati, Feeded, Saily and Tari’ak, are gaining a regional presence. The growth of the entrepreneurship culture is starting to attract global investors, but there are lessons to be learned.
